Public Funding Programs
Many governments offer grants and low‑interest loans for renewable energy projects. Key programs include:
- EU Horizon Europe – research and demonstration funding.
- German KfW Green Energy Loan – favorable rates for hydrogen plants.
- Swiss Innosuisse Innovation Grant – supports pilot projects.
Green Bonds and ESG Investing
Investors are increasingly allocating capital to projects with strong Environmental, Social and Governance (ESG) metrics. Issuing a green bond can provide upfront capital while showcasing your commitment to sustainability.
Project Finance Structures
Project finance isolates the investment from the parent company, using the cash flow of the hydrogen plant as repayment. Benefits include:
- Limited recourse – risk is confined to the project assets.
- Attractive returns for lenders due to long‑term power purchase agreements (PPAs).
- Flexibility to involve multiple stakeholders.
